== Subsets and Supersets af AFDOs (Pages AFDO, 2afdo, 3afdo, …n-afdo) == | |||
Flora, you have put so much effort and time into maintaining and editing the ''AFDO'' pages - thank you for that. | |||
There is one aspect of these pages that I'm not sure I understood correctly, so I'll just address my question directly to you. It's about the terms ''subset'' and ''superset'' of an AFDO. | |||
On the ''2afdo'' page we read:<br> | |||
2afdo ''“is a superset of 1afdo (equivalent to 1edo) and a subset of 3afdo”''.<br> | |||
Can 2afdo be a subset of 3afdo when no intervals are shared (except the octaves)? | |||
Similarly, the ''3afdo'' page explains...<br> | |||
3afdo ''“is a superset of 2afdo and a subset of 4afdo”'',<br> | |||
but neither has any intervals in common with 3afdo (except octaves). | |||
The AFDO page tells us that in general...<br> | |||
''“All AFDOs are subsets of just intonation, and up to transposition, any AFDO is a superset of a smaller AFDO and a subset of a larger AFDO (i.e. n-afdo is a superset of (n - 1)-afdo and a subset of (n + 1)-afdo for any integer n > 1).”''<br> | |||
As you may have noticed I’m not convinced that the example given is correct. | |||
I've been playing around with overtone scales for a while now, in order to construct a prototype keyboard with dynamic intonation control. Personally I would summarize my experience with this project as follows: | |||
• To create a '''superset''' of an n-afdo , I’d multiply ''n'' by a (preferably small) integer number including 2 (i.e. 9-afdo is a superset of 3-afdo). | |||
• To create a '''subset''' of an n-afdo , I’d divide ''n'' by any of its prime factors | |||
(i.e. 5-afdo and 3-afdo are both subsets of 15-afdo). | |||
